CRICKET.

Per Press Association—Copyright. Received July 20, 8.30 ajn. ' LONDON, July 19. Yorkshire, with eleven wins and seven, draws, is leading for the County Championship. Surrey, Kent and Middlesex each lost it 6 match. Rain ruined the Hayes benefit match at the Oval, and consequently Lancashire will replay Surrey in September.
